Chassis Power Connection

Warning Before connecting or disconnecting ground or power wires to the chassis, ensure that power is removed from the DC circuit. To ensure that all power is OFF, locate the circuit breaker on the panel board that services the DC circuit, switch the circuit breaker to the OFF position, and tape the switch handle of the circuit breaker in the OFF position.

Cisco Systems Gateway Controllers play a pivotal role in the modern networking landscape, particularly within service provider infrastructures. These devices serve as critical components that facilitate the efficient management of voice, video, and data traffic, enabling seamless communication across diverse networks. Combining robustness, scalability, and advanced features, Cisco's Gateway Controllers provide businesses with the tools necessary to optimize their network environments.

One of the standout features of Cisco Gateway Controllers is their ability to handle various signaling protocols, including SIP (Session Initiation Protocol), H.323, and MGCP (Media Gateway Control Protocol). This flexibility ensures interoperability with a wide range of telecom systems and devices, which is crucial for organizations transitioning to IP-based communications.

Integration of voice and video services is made seamless through advanced transcoding capabilities. Cisco Gateway Controllers can convert media streams between different codecs, ensuring high-quality communication regardless of the endpoint's capabilities. This is particularly valuable for enterprises with a mix of legacy and modern communications equipment, as it protects existing investments while facilitating growth.

Traffic management is another significant characteristic of Cisco Gateway Controllers. They utilize sophisticated traffic engineering techniques to prioritize real-time communication signals and optimize bandwidth allocation. Quality of Service (QoS) mechanisms ensure that voice and video traffic is given priority over data traffic, reducing latency and maintaining call quality even during peak usage.
